Форматы данных: представление и кодирование информации в компьютере

Автор работы: Пользователь скрыл имя, 22 Мая 2013 в 18:36, курсовая работа

Описание

Целью курсовой работы является рассмотрение принципов представления и кодирования различных данных компьютером. Задачи курсовой работы:
- изучить возможные форматы данных компьютера.
- исследовать принципы кодирования чисел, текста, графики и звука;
- научится работать с программой Microsoft Excel, выполнив практическую часть работы;
Объектом исследования являются форматы данных, с которыми работает компьютер, предмет исследования – способы их представления и кодирования.

Содержание

ВВЕДЕНИЕ …………………………………………………………….. 3
1. ТЕОРЕТИЧЕСКАЯ ЧАСТЬ. ФОРМАТЫ ДАННЫХ: ПРЕДСТАВЛЕНИЕ И КОДИРОВАНИЕ ИНФОРМАЦИИ В КОМПЬЮТЕРЕ
1.1. Компьютерное кодирование чисел ………………………………. 6
1.2. Компьютерное кодирование текста ……………………………… 8
1.3. Компьютерное кодирование графики ……………………………. 10
1.4. Компьютерное кодирование звука ……………………………….. 12
2. ПРАКТИЧЕСКАЯ ЧАСТЬ. ВАРИАНТ 20
2.1. Постановка задачи ………………………………………………… 15
2.2. Описание алгоритма решения задачи ……………………………. 16
ЗАКЛЮЧЕНИЕ ………………………………………………………… 20
СПИСОК ИСПОЛЬЗОВАННОЙ ЛИТЕРАТУРЫ ……………………. 21

Работа состоит из  1 файл

информатика1.doc

— 627.00 Кб (Скачать документ)

 

Основные комбинации цвета

Таблица 1

Цвет

R

G

B

Черный

0

0

0

Синий

0

0

1

Зеленый

0

1

0

Голубой

0

1

1

Красный

1

0

0

Пурпурный

1

0

1

Желтый

1

1

0

Белый

1

1

1


 

Качество кодирования  изображения зависит от двух параметров.

Во-первых, качество кодирования  изображения тем выше, чем меньше размер точки и соответственно большее  количество точек составляет изображение.

Во-вторых, чем большее количество цветов, то есть большее количество возможных состояний точки изображения, используется, тем более качественно кодируется изображение (каждая точка несет большее количество информации). Совокупность используемых в наборе цветов образует палитру цветов.

Графическая информация на экране монитора представляется в  виде растрового изображения, которое  формируется из определенного количества строк, которые в свою очередь  содержат определенное количество точек (пикселей). Качество изображения определяется разрешающей способностью монитора, т.е. количеством точек, из которых оно складывается. Чем больше разрешающая способность, то есть чем больше количество строк растра и точек в строке, тем выше качество изображения. В современных персональных компьютерах обычно используются три основные разрешающие способности экрана: 800х600, 1024х768 и 1280х1024 точки.

Цветные изображения  формируются в соответствии с  двоичным кодом цвета каждой точки, хранящимся в видеопамяти.. Цветные  изображения могут иметь различную глубину цвета, которая задается количеством битов, используемым для кодирования цвета точки. Наиболее распространенными значениями глубины цвета являются 8, 16, 24 или 32 бита.

В противоположность  растровой графике векторное изображение состоит из геометрических примитивов: линия, прямоугольник, окружность и т.д. Каждый элемент векторного изображения является объектом, который описывается с помощью специального языка (математических уравнения линий, дуг, окружностей и т.д.). Сложные объекты (ломаные линии, различные геометрические фигуры) представляются в виде совокупности элементарных графических объектов. Объекты векторного изображения, в отличие от растровой графики, могут изменять свои размеры без потери качества (при увеличении растрового изображения увеличивается зернистость).

 

1.4. Компьютерное кодирование звука

 

Из курса физики известно, что звук - это колебание частиц воздуха, непрерывный сигнал с меняющейся амплитудой (Рис. 1).

Рис.1. Графическое отображение звуковых волн

При кодировании звука  этот сигнал надо представить в виде последовательности нулей и единиц. Как это происходит в микрофоне? Через равные промежутки времени, очень часто (десятки тысяч раз в секунду) измеряется амплитуда колебаний. Каждое измерение производится с ограниченной точностью и записывается в двоичном виде. Частота, с которой записывается амплитуда, называется частотой дискретизации. Полученный ступенчатый сигнал сначала сглаживается посредством аналогового фильтра, а затем преобразуется в звук с помощью усилителя и динамика.

На качество воспроизведения  закодированного звука в основном влияют два параметра: частота дискретизации - количество измерений амплитуды за секунду в герцах и глубина кодирования звука - размер в битах, отводимый под запись значения амплитуды. Например, при записи на компакт-диски (CD) используются 16-разрядные значения, а частота дискретизации равна 44032 Гц. Эти параметры обеспечивают превосходное качество звучания речи и музыки. Для стереозвука отдельно записывают данные для левого и для правого канала.

Если преобразовать  звук в электрический сигнал (например, с помощью микрофона), мы увидим плавно изменяющееся с течением времени напряжение. Для компьютерной обработки такой аналоговый сигнал нужно каким-то образом преобразовать в последовательность двоичных чисел.

Поступают следующим образом: измеряют напряжение через равные промежутки времени и записывают полученные значения в память компьютера. Этот процесс называется дискретизацией (или оцифровкой), а устройство, выполняющее его - аналого-цифровым преобразователем (АЦП) (Рис. 2).

Рис.2 Аналогово-цифровое преобразование звука

Для того чтобы воспроизвести  закодированный таким образом звук, нужно выполнить обратное преобразование (для него служит цифро-аналоговый преобразователь- ЦАП), а затем сгладить получившийся ступенчатый сигнал.

Чем выше частота дискретизации (т. е. количество отсчетов за секунду) и чем больше разрядов отводится  для каждого отсчета, тем точнее будет представлен звук. Но при этом увеличивается и размер звукового файла. Поэтому в зависимости от характера звука, требований, предъявляемых к его качеству и объему занимаемой памяти, выбирают некоторые компромиссные значения.

Описанный способ кодирования  звуковой информации достаточно универсален, он позволяет представить любой звук и преобразовывать его самыми разными способами. Но бывают случаи, когда выгодней действовать по-иному.

Человек издавна использует довольно компактный способ представления  музыки - нотную запись. В ней специальными символами указывается, какой высоты звук, на каком инструменте и как сыграть. Фактически, ее можно считать алгоритмом для музыканта, записанным на особом формальном языке. В 1983 г. ведущие производители компьютеров и музыкальных синтезаторов разработали стандарт, определивший такую систему кодов. Он получил название MIDI.

Конечно, такая система  кодирования позволяет записать далеко не всякий звук, она годится  только для инструментальной музыки. Но есть у нее и неоспоримые  преимущества: чрезвычайно компактная запись, естественность для музыканта (практически любой MIDI-редактор позволяет работать с музыкой в виде обычных нот), легкость замены инструментов, изменения темпа и тональности мелодии.

Существуют и другие, чисто компьютерные, форматы записи музыки. Среди них следует отметить формат MP3, позволяющий с очень большим качеством и степенью сжатия кодировать музыку. При этом вместо 18-20 музыкальных композиций на стандартный компакт-диск (CD-ROM) помещается около 200. композициями.[5]

 

 

 

 

 

2. ПРАКТИЧЕСКАЯ ЧАСТЬ

ВАРИАНТ 20

 

2.1. Постановка задачи

  В течение дня  в салоне сотовой связи проданы мобильные телефоны, код, модель и цена которых указаны в таблице 1. В таблице 2 указаны код и количество проданных телефонов различных моделей.

  Для решения задачи необходимо следующее:

  1. В итоговой таблице  «Ведомость продаж» обеспечить автоматическое заполнение данными столбцов «Модель мобильного телефона», «Цена, руб.», «Продано, шт.», используя исходные данные таблиц 2 и 3.

  2. Организовать межтабличные связи с использованием функций ВПР или ПРОСМОТР для автоматического запроса цены и количества проданных телефонов.

  3. Рассчитать сумму,  полученную от продаж каждой из моделей итоговую сумму продаж.

  4. Сформировать документ  «Ведомость продаж мобильных телефонов».

  5. Результаты представить  в  графическом виде и  провести анализ результатов.

Прайс-лист

Таблица 2

Код мобильного телефона

Модель мобильного телефона

Цена, руб.

100

LG-Optimus One

9000

101

Nokia E7

28000

102

HTC Desire S

22000

103

Apple iPhone 4

35000

104

Nokia N8

18000

105

Sony Ericsson Xperia arc

20000


 

 

 

Список продаж

Таблица 3

Номер продажи

Код мобильного телефона

Продано, шт

1

100

2

2

101

4

3

102

5

4

103

1

5

104

4

6

105

3


 

Ведомость продаж

Таблица 4

Код мобильного телефона

Модель мобильного телефона

Цена

Продано

Сумма

         
         
         
         
         
         
         

 

 

2.2. Описание  алгоритма решения задачи

1) Запустить табличный  процессор MS Excel.

2) Создать книгу с  именем «Ведомость продаж».

3) На рабочем листе MS Excel создать таблицу с базовыми данными продажах.

4) Заполнить таблицу  с исходными данными (рис. 3.).

Рис. 3. Таблица с исходными данными

5) С помощью функции ВПР обеспечиваем межтабличные связи для автоматического запроса цены и количества проданных телефонов. (Рис.4.)

Например, для заполнения ячейки В12 используем функцию =ВПР(A12;$A$1:$C$7;2;0)

Рис. 4. Автоматическое заполнение ячеек

 

6) Заполним графу «сумма» в Рис. 5, используя функции умножения и суммирования. В ячейку Е12 внесем формулу:

=C12*D12

В ячейку Е18 вносим формулу:

=СУММ(E12:E17)

Полученная таблица  представлена на Рис.5.

Рис. 5. Ведомость продаж

7) По полученным данным построим диаграмму с отражением суммы денег, полученных от продаж. (Рис.6.).

 

 

Рис.6. Результаты вычислений в графическом виде

 

8) Анализ результатов.

Проведя данную работу, рассчитали доход от продаж мобильных телефонов, представили отдельно результаты для  каждой модели в процентном соотношении  от полной стоимости продаж. Выяснили, что  наибольший доход получили от продаж телефонов марки Nokia Е7 (112 тыс. руб.), наименьший доход – LG - Optimus One (18 тыс. руб) [1, стр. 376]

 

 

 

 

 

 

 

 

 

 

ЗАКЛЮЧЕНИЕ

 

С тех пор как люди научились думать и считать, не было изобретено лучшего способа представления  чисел и других данных для анализа и принятия решений, как занесение их в разного рода таблицы. Долгое время и до недавних пор это были ряды и столбцы цифр в различных ведомостях, формах, бланках, отчетах и иных бумажных документах. Сведение данных в такие таблицы и расчеты вручную либо с помощью подручных средств типа счетов или калькулятора может потребовать многих часов кропотливого труда. С изобретением компьютеров появилась альтернатива: рутинные обязанности по обработке данных понемногу стали поручать машине. Решением проблемы явились электронные таблицы, которые в простой и естественной форме соединяют преимущества обоих способов работы с данными. Пользователь (служащий) получил возможность для размещения данных использовать таблицы на экране монитора, а для их обработки — стандартный набор арифметических операций.

Информация о работе Форматы данных: представление и кодирование информации в компьютере